### Claims Principal Factory
Abp abstracts the way that authentication creates `ClaimsPrincipal`. You can provide a custom `IAbpClaimsPrincipalContributor` to add additional claims.
Claims are important elements of authentication and authorization. ABP uses the `IAbpClaimsPrincipalFactory` service to create claims on authentication. This service was designed as extensible. If you need to add your custom claims to the authentication ticket, you can implement the `IAbpClaimsPrincipalContributor` in your application.
